WebMarine Corps Leadership Traits • Dependability The certainty of proper performance of duty. • Bearing Creating a favorable impression in carriage, appearance and personal conduct at all times. • Courage The mental quality that recognizes fear of danger or criticism, but enables a man to proceed in the face of it with calmness and firmness.
